Understanding How Update Trackers Work

At their core, update trackers are software applications or online services that monitor specified websites or product pages for changes. They typically operate as follows:

  1. Website Crawling: The tracker regularly visits the websites you've designated, scanning the product pages for specific information, such as the price, availability, and any relevant product descriptions.
  2. Data Extraction: The tracker extracts the relevant data from the page, such as the current price and whether the item is in stock.
  3. Change Detection: The tracker compares the extracted data with its previously recorded information. If it detects a change, such as a price drop or a restock, it triggers an alert.
  4. Notification: The tracker sends you a notification through email, SMS, push notification, or another chosen method, informing you about the update.
  5. Data Logging: The tracker often logs the price history and availability data, allowing you to visualize price trends over time.

Types of Update Trackers

Update trackers come in various forms, each with its own advantages and disadvantages. Here's a breakdown of the most common types:

  • Dedicated Price Tracking Websites: These websites specialize in tracking prices across multiple retailers and product categories. They often provide advanced features like price history charts, competitor comparisons, and deal aggregation. Examples include:
    • CamelCamelCamel (for Amazon): Primarily focused on Amazon products, this tracker provides detailed price history graphs and alerts for price drops.
    • PriceRunner: A price comparison website that tracks prices from numerous online retailers, allowing you to find the best deals on a wide range of products.
    • PC Part Picker: Essential for PC builders, this website tracks the prices of individual PC components from various retailers, helping you find the best deals and ensure compatibility.
  • Browser Extensions: These lightweight tools integrate directly into your web browser, allowing you to track prices on any website with a single click. They are convenient and easy to use, but may have limited features compared to dedicated websites. Popular options include:
    • Honey: Automatically searches for and applies coupon codes while you shop online, and also offers price tracking features.
    • Keepa (for Amazon): Similar to CamelCamelCamel, this extension provides detailed price history charts and alerts directly on Amazon product pages.
    • Rakuten (formerly Ebates): Offers cashback rewards and also includes a browser extension that alerts you to price drops and deals.
  • Mobile Apps: These apps allow you to track prices on the go and receive notifications directly on your smartphone or tablet. They are ideal for staying informed while you're away from your computer.
  • Custom Scripts: For advanced users, creating custom scripts using programming languages like Python can provide the most flexibility and control. This option requires technical expertise but allows you to tailor the tracker to your specific needs.

Step-by-Step Guide to Using Update Trackers Effectively

Once you've chosen an update tracker, follow these steps to maximize your savings:

  1. Identify the Gear You Want: Create a list of the gaming gear you're interested in purchasing, including specific models, brands, and retailers.
  2. Set Up Your Tracker: Install the browser extension, download the mobile app, or register an account on the dedicated website you've chosen.
  3. Add Products to Your Watchlist: Add the desired products to your tracker's watchlist. This usually involves copying and pasting the product URL or searching for the item within the tracker's interface.
  4. Configure Your Alerts: Customize your alert settings to receive notifications when the price drops below a certain threshold, when the item is back in stock, or when a new deal is available.
  5. Monitor Price History: Use the tracker's price history charts to analyze price trends and determine if a current offer is genuinely a good deal. Look for patterns and identify the best times to buy.
  6. Compare Prices Across Retailers: Utilize the tracker's price comparison feature to identify the retailer offering the lowest price. Consider shipping costs and potential discounts when making your decision.
  7. Act Quickly When a Deal Arises: Be prepared to act quickly when you receive a notification about a price drop or a special offer. Popular items often sell out quickly, so don't hesitate to make your purchase.
  8. Combine Trackers with Other Savings Strategies: Don't rely solely on update trackers. Combine them with other savings strategies, such as:
    • Using Coupon Codes: Search for coupon codes online before making your purchase. Browser extensions like Honey can automate this process.
    • Cashback Rewards: Sign up for cashback programs like Rakuten to earn a percentage of your purchase price back.
    • Credit Card Rewards: Use a credit card that offers rewards points or cashback on online purchases.
    • Manufacturer Rebates: Check if the manufacturer offers any rebates on the products you're interested in.
    • Refurbished or Used Gear: Consider purchasing refurbished or used gaming gear from reputable sources to save money.
  9. Be Patient: The best deals often require patience. Don't rush into a purchase unless you're confident that you're getting a good price.
